WebMar 24, 2024 · Tautochrone Problem. The problem of finding the curve down which a bead placed anywhere will fall to the bottom in the same amount of time. The solution is a cycloid , a fact first discovered and published by Huygens in Horologium oscillatorium (1673). WebFeb 21, 2024 · Consider the cycloid traced out by the point P . Let ( x, y) be the coordinates of P as it travels over the plane . The point P = ( x, y) is described by the equations: x = a ( θ − sin θ) y = a ( 1 − cos θ) Proof Let the circle have rolled so that the radius to the point P = ( x, y) is at angle θ to the vertical .
WebIn geometry, a cycloid is the curve traced by a point on a circle as it rolls along a straight line without slipping.
